The GSA is seeking Small Business, SBA certified 8(a) Business, SBA certified HUBZone Small Business, Women-Owned Small Business, and/or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business sources with current and relevant experience, personnel, and capability to self-perform Design Build Construction to Design/Install a Fire Suppression System, Replacement of Roofs, and Electrical Distribution Systems for the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) Customer Service Center located in Memphis, TN. The North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) Code is 236220 (Construction and Institutional Building Construction) with a Small Business Size Standard of $45 million. Project Summary: The project consists of three (3) main components: Roof replacement, Electrical Distribution Systems upgrades, and replacement of the Fire Suppression System: 1. The first component of work is the design, repair, replacement, and improvement of thermal and moisture protection systems and rainwater drainage systems at roofs of the Internal Revenue Service Center in Memphis, Tennessee. The existing roof covers involve approximately 836,000 square feet of built-up asphalt membrane; bituminous base flashing; metal counterflashing and parapet copings; rigid insulation over metal decking; internal rain leaders and conductors; and associated materials and components. As-built drawings indicate that the metal deck and structural steel supports provide the roof slope. The designer-builder shall design and construct appropriate repairs, replacements, and improvements of roof cover and rainwater drainage systems for up to 618,000 square feet of this facility. The designer-builder shall confirm the quantity of roof area prior to submitting a proposal. In addition, the project requires a web-camera surveillance system to monitor on-site roof work through project completion. The designer-builder shall also provide a twenty-year (20-year), no- dollar-limit (NDL) warranty on all areas of roof replacement. The warranties shall include wind riders to cover damage caused by winds speeds up to one-hundred forty (140) miles per hour or up to the design wind speed for the project location, whichever is less. 2. The Second component of work is replacement of the existing Westinghouse POW-R-100 Circuit Breakers in the Memphis IRS Service Center Buildings which includes a total of twenty-six (26) Circuit Breakers. The designer-builder shall provide a one-year (1-year) warranty on all replaced breakers, including all parts and labor. 3. The Third component of this project is replacement of the fire alarm system, including all fire alarm control panels, initiating devices, notification devices, wiring, control modules, monitor modules, NAC panels, tamper switches, flow switches, etc. within the Memphis IRS Service Center Complex. The new Fire Alarm system and installing contractor are required to be UL certified.
